What Are the Best Cold Email Software for Gsuite? 1000 Unique Recipient Per Month.

I'm a freelancer who offers SEO and web design services for business in my country, I manually research and collect email from local business directories and find those that meet my criteria (outdated website, bad website performance, etc..).

At the moment I'm using Gmelius to send campaigns with 6 follow-ups, so a total of 7 emails to a unique recipient. I only schedule to send at weekday, so on any given day, there'll be 50 first emails to new recipients and 300 emails that follow up with the previous recipients.

Although Gmelius does the work now, I'm looking for a better solution because Gmelius is bad at reporting and tracking, their analytics are just not useful. Also if there's a bounce email, out-of-office email or any soft and hard bounce, I'll have to manually remove the email from my list, and their interface makes it so hard to remove the email.

Currently, I'm comparing these few products and hoping someone with experience can help me choose one:

  • Mailshake $40/mo (I like the simple UI, however heard someone say the email goes into spam a lot of time.)
  • Woodpecker.co $40/mo (Human-like sending delay between emails helps? Soft/Hardbounce detection sounds helpful)
  • Reply.io $55/mo (limits 1000 contact each month)
  • Gmass $20/mo (Mixed review)
  • Lemlist $49/mo (they claimed their inbox rate is high, and spambox is low)

Ultimately I'm trying to increase open and reply rate, which means tools with a good statistic report and tracking that I can act on and A/B testing is a plus, I also hope to get my email to send into their inbox instead of spam. (btw I'm using TheChecker for email validation)
